Hey guys!

I have a gig tonight. It is not my first or anything (maybe 8th performance). Normally I wouldnt be very nervous, but this is no normal gig. Its a local band competition. Half my town + friends and my dad are coming to watch us (and 5 other bands) play this evening. Also we will be judged if we are good enough for the next round based on sound, composition, performance and technique. Eventually 8 out of 28 bands will make it to the semi-finals. I cannot even concentrate @ work right now sad.gif. Im really anxious to play, but also very nervous. Im affraid this will affect my playing in a bad way tonight. You guys got any tips to loosen up my mind, and prevent me from making mistakes or getting a blackout on stage hahah?tongue.gif

No really, I think you should get together with the band a couple of hours before the gig, sit down a talk about the gig in a relaxed way. Have fun and don't take it too seriously! If you do up on stage feeling relaxed and with the intention to have fun it will be nothing but fun up there smile.gif

Start with an easy song!!!!!! Gives you a chance to feel the monitors (medhörning) and the stage and just get a bit warmed up before starting for real.

You can only do one thing... go on stage and rock the place, give your best and don't worry about anything else. All the other bands will most likely be as nervous as you are in the moment, thats normal, just don't let it take over. Just focus on your songs and your guitar, do your thing and don't worry about the competition, the audience or the other bands, just see it as a normal gig. And forget about drinking, this never helps, you will just play worse.

Hey guys! So here is a little report on the gig smile.gif.

It was veeery crouded, full house hahah. The gig itself went pretty good. All songs went well, and there were only a few small mistakes, but the audience said they did not hear it at all, so that's great hehe. The performance was not very good... I tried to look up from my guitar, but that only resulted in mistakes most of the time. Some parts were just simple chords, so I took those opportunities to look at the audience. Between the songs we were a bit messy in my opinion. Not mentioning the names of the songs, and playing small bits to get our sound right. I messed up one solo, wich resulted in losing track of were I was in the solo. But luckely I improvised my way out haha.

The reactions of the audience were pretty good. And the cheers were pretty loud after each song smile.gif. People stated that we were original compared to the other bands they had seen this competition. So I hope the judge will let us pass to the next round, so we can work at our stage performance.

Overall Im pretty statisfied smile.gif. People found the music interesting. We now know very well what we need to work on the next time we have a gig. My dad wanted to take pictures but couldn't get through the many people there haha. So Im affraid I dont have anything to show you guys yet. The judge will send a letter to us containing the judges opinions and stuff like that after the competition is over. I will translate it in english and post it here when I get it smile.gif.

Thanks everyone for the tips and support! It really helped alot! As soon as the first song started my nerves were almost completely gone
